If I have a 12V globe (or any voltage for that matter), does the globe
"care" whether it is run on AC or DC?
"Care" in the sense of:
- will it work?
- will it last as long (or maybe longer)?
In particular, we're thinking of moving out of town and building a house
without connecting to the electricity grid.
We like the 12V lights that have now become so popular. These run from
mains via a transformer. The transformer converts mains AC to 12V AC.
If we ran 12V batteries for the house, it would make sense to just run 12V
DC to all our lighting rather than convert to mains AC via the inverter and
then back to the 12V with the above transformer(s).
